GoE means any government and/or any entity that is directly or indirectly controlled by, under common control with or that control a government or a governmental entity. For purposes of this definition control includes direct or indirect ownership of or the right to exercise: (a) more than 50% (fifty percent) of the outstanding shares or securities entitled to vote for the election of directors or similar managing authority of the subject entity; or (b) more than 50% (fifty percent) of the voting rights held by the owners of the subject entity;

  • Freeboard means a factor of safety usually expressed in feet above a flood level for purposes of floodplain management. "Freeboard" tends to compensate for the many unknown factors that could contribute to flood heights greater than the height calculated for a selected size flood and floodway conditions, such as wave action, blockage of bridge or culvert openings, and the hydrological effect of urbanization of the watershed.
